2-N-(4-aminocyclohexyl)-9-ethyl-6-N-(4-piperidin-1-ylsulfonylphenyl)purine-2,6-diamine

Also Known As: AAE871, 2-N-(4-aminocyclohexyl)-9-ethyl-6-N-(4-piperidin-1-ylsulfonylphenyl)purine-2,6-diamine, N-(4-aminocyclohexyl)-9-ethyl-N'-[4-(1-piperidylsulfonyl)phenyl]purine-2,6-diamine

CAS: 289479-07-8
Molecular Formula C24H34N8O2S
Molecular Weight 498.25 g/mol
LogP 3.4462
Topological Polar Surface Area 131.06 Ų
Hydrogen Bond Donors 3
Hydrogen Bond Acceptors 8
Rotatable Bonds 7
Exact Mass 498.25253
Heavy Atoms 35
Complexity 1260.6661

Chemical Identifiers

CAS Number 289479-07-8
SMILES CCN1C=NC2=C(N=C(N=C21)NC3CCC(CC3)N)NC4=CC=C(C=C4)S(=O)(=O)N5CCCCC5

Property Insights of AAE871

The XLogP value of 3.4462 indicates that AAE871 is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 131.06 Ų falls within the moderate polarity range, balancing permeability and solubility for AAE871. Following Lipinski's Rule of Five, AAE871 has 3 hydrogen bond donor(s) and 8 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
